What is the Cornucopia bloodbath?

The Cornucopia bloodbath was an event that took place at the beginning of every edition of the Hunger Games from their very installment, as most of the tributes competed for valuable weapons, food, water and packs full of other valuable supplies that could be useful during the Games.

Is there guns in the Hunger Games?

Guns. Guns are never used in the Hunger Games—because they would give the wielder an unfair advantage—but are instead used by Peacekeepers and the Panem military. They are manufactured in District 2, which is also where most Peacekeepers and soldiers come from.

When was the first Hunger Games book published?

The Hunger Games was released in September 2008. Catching Fire, the second book of The Hunger Games series, was published September 1, 2009. Mockingjay was released August 24, 2010, and The Ballad of Songbirds and Snakes was published May 19, 2020. “A home run of a best seller by publishing’s standards.”

How many copies of the Hunger Games books have been sold?

Scholastic has more than 70 million copies of the original three books in The Hunger Games trilogy in print and digital formats in the U.S. (more than 29 million copies of The Hunger Games; more than 21 million copies of Catching Fire; and more than 20 million copies of Mockingjay ), and more than 100 million copies in print worldwide.
